Odo of Cluny (878 - November 18, 942) was a prominent abbot who played a significant role in the reform of monastic life in medieval Europe. During his tenure as the abbot of the Abbey of Cluny, he initiated reforms that had a profound impact on religious life across the continent.

Jean Decety is a renowned cognitive neuroscientist specializing in affective neuroscience and child development. Born in 1960, he currently serves as a professor of psychology at the University of Chicago. Decety's research focuses on the neural basis of human emotional experiences, particularly facial expressions and social cognition, and how these experiences influence social interactions and moral judgments.
